Aula sobre CNC com função de circulo em máquina ROMI

download Aula sobre CNC com função de circulo em máquina ROMI

of 45

Transcript of Aula sobre CNC com função de circulo em máquina ROMI

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    1/45

     

    Programação para centro de usinagem- Linguagem ISO

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    2/45

     

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    3/45

     

    Programação para centro de usinagemLinguagem ISO

    G17 Definição do plano de trabalho X , Y.

    G18 Definição do plano de trabalho X, Z.

    G19 Definição do plano de trabalho Y, Z.

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    4/45

     

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    5/45

     

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    6/45

     

    • G01 X Y Z

    •  Exeplo de pro!raação

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    7/45

     

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    8/45

     

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    9/45

     

    • POSICIONAMENTO POLAR COM "RA"

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    10/45

     

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    11/45

     

    • POSICIONAMENTO POLAR COM "RA"

    • "#ando $ e % fore #&ado& para definir o'iento&n# blo(o de interpolação linear polar, ele& pro'o(a

    # de&lo(aento da po&ição at#al da ferraenta at) oponto final de&e*ado +definido pela di&tn(ia $ e n!#lo

     %-.

    • R de'e &er &oente in(reental, ne&ta (obinação #o'iento de'e pre(eder o blo(o

    • "#ando A for ab&ol#to, ele ) edido da linha po&iti'a do

    eixo X pa&&ando pela po&ição at#al da ferraenta.

    • "#ando A for in(reental, ele ) edido a partir de #alinha ia!inria /#e &e prolon!a do o'iento anterior.

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    12/45

     

    • 0010G99• 000 G90

    • ......• ......• 0090 G2 X2 Y2

    • 0100G01 X3. Y1.4• 0110G01 $55. %84

    • o# G21 r55.a35.134•

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    13/45

     

    • !unção #$%& #$'  6nterpolação (ir(#lar 

    •  %tra')& da& f#nçe& pode&e !erar ar(o& no& &entido&horrio G o# antihorrioG5

    • :intaxe;

    • G0 +....-

    • 2nde;

    • X, Y, Z ?onto final da interpolação

    •  6 @entro da interpolação no eixo X

    • = @entro da interpolação no eixo Y• > @entro da interpolação no eixo Z

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    14/45

     

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    15/45

     

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    16/45

     

    Se o p(ano)

    ?ro!rae Pore)emp(o

    o ponto final(o

    o (entro (o

    XY+G17- X e Y 6 e = G0 XY6= A

    XZ+G18- X e Z 6 e > G0 XY6> A

    YZ+G19- Y e Z = e > G0 YZ=> A

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    17/45

     

    • INTERPOLA*+O CIRC,LAR

    • Betra& aiC&(#la& odo ab&ol#to• Betra& inC&(#la& odo in(reental

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    18/45

     

    • ASOL,TO .#/$0

    1esen2ar (ousa

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    19/45

     

    • INCREMENTAL .#/30 

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    20/45

     

    • !unç+o 4;

    • "#ando pro!raada *#ntaente (o a& f#nçe& G1,Ge G5 pro'o(ar a in&erção de # (hanfro o# raio,entre o

    o'iento !erado pelo blo(o /#e (ont) a f#nção " eo blo(o &e!#inte.

    • :e o 'alor de " for po&iti'o e&pe(ifi(ar o raio do ar(o a

    &er in&erido entre o& doi& o'iento&,e &e o 'alor de "for ne!ati'o e&pe(ifi(ar a dien&ão do (hanfro a &erin&erido entre o& doi& o'iento&.

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    21/45

     

    • 40 GXY• 0 G1 Y50.• 70X10.

    • 80 X0.Y0.• 90GX30.Y0 60. =0 "4.• 100G1X.

    ?ro!raar (o G0 e "

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    22/45

     

    G01 X0 Y0X0. "10.

    Y0."4.

    X0 "14.Y0

    ?ro!raar (o G01 e "

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    23/45

     

    • 0 GX0Y0

    • 70G1 X70."10.

    • 80X50.Y40.

    • 90X0• 100 Y0

    ?ro!raar (o G01 e "

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    24/45

     

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    25/45

     

    • !unção #$5  G04 X Y " D

    • ?erite pro!raar reta& /#e &ão tan!ente& a # ar(o(#*o raio e (oordenada& de (entro &ão (onhe(ido&.

    • 2& ponto& de tan!Fn(ia &ão a#toati(aentedeterinado& pelo (oando, ali'iando a ne(e&&idade dopro!raador (al(#lar e&te& ponto&.

    • G04 ) odal e perane(e e efeito at) /#e &e*apro!raado #a f#nção G00, G01, G0, G05

    • a f#nção G04 e /#e não ) e&pe(ifi(ado a&(oordenada& de (entro do ar(o ) # (oando e&pe(ial/#e ) #tiliHado para fe(har o per(#r&o.

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    26/45

     

    •  (oordenada& do (entro do ar(o +X,Y,Z- e a f#nção "e&pe(ifi(a o raio do ar(o.

    • :e a f#nção " não for definida, o# &e " for i!#al a Herodeterinar # ponto +(anto 'i'o-.

    • :e o 'alor de " for po&iti'o o ar(o &er exe(#tado no&entido antihorrio.

    • :e o 'alor de " for ne!ati'o o ar(o &er exe(#tado no&entido horrio

    •  % f#nção D, ne&te (a&o, infora ao (oando paraaraHenar a (oordenada do ponto de tan!Fn(ia para

    &er #&ada no t)rino do per(#r&o 

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    27/45

     

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    28/45

     

    • Compensação de Raio de Corte .CRC0da 6erramenta em centro de usinagem

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    29/45

     

    • E)emp(o de compensação de Raio de Corte .CRC0da 6erramenta em centro de usinagem

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    30/45

     

    • CICLOS !I7OS

    • a 'eH definido # (i(lo fixo n# pro!raa,

    e&te at#ar a#toati(aente apI& #o'iento e rpido +G00- no plano XY.

    • 2& (i(lo& fixo& &ão odai& e perane(e ati'o&

    at) /#e &e*a (an(elado& (o # G80.

    • :e for pro!raado # no'o (i(lo fixo &e

    (an(elar o anterior, o (oando &epre a&ea exe(#ção do Cltio (i(lo pro!raado, at) /#eha*a o (an(elaento.

    •#83 R 9 ! @6@B2 J6X2 DE J$%KL2

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    31/45

     

    •#83 R 9 !  @6@B2 J6X2 DE J$%KL2

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    32/45

     

    • GZ50. A

    • G81 $. Z4. J140A• X0.Y50. A

    • X40.Y14.A

    •  G80A

    • :e aproxia &e

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    33/45

     

    • @6@B2 J6X2 DE J$%KL2 @2M?E$M%N@6% #8%

    • 2 (i(lo fixo G8 ) indi(ado para alar!aento o#operaçe& de f#ra(ão onde a peça ne(e&&ita de#a peranFn(ia.

    •  % ferraenta o'e&e e rpido at) o plano$,f#ra e 'elo(idade de a'anço at) a

    prof#ndidade final, forne(endo # tepo deperanFn(ia op(ional, e retorna ao plano$ o# po&ição ini(ial da ferraenta

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    34/45

     

    G8 $ Z D J A

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    35/45

     

    • GZ50. A

    • G8$.Z4.D4.J140A

    • X0.Y50. A• X40. A

    • G80

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    36/45

     

    • @6@B2 J6X2 DE J$%@L2 @2M DE:@%$G% #8'

    • blo(o G85 exe(#ta #a operação /#e in(l#i #

    o'iento de retração o# #a peranFn(ia para a/#ebra o# reoção do (a'a(o.

    •  ?ode&e e&pe(ifi(ar #a peranFn(ia e

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    37/45

     

    • "#ando não pro!raado o(orrer a retração at) o

    plano$ apI& (ada in(reento de prof#ndidade. "#ando? diferente de Hero retrair ao Z ini(ial no final do (i(lo

    • : Depoi& da retração, a ferraenta 'oltar e rpido,

    prof#ndidade anteriorente atin!ida eno& o 'alor deOP a&ido por defa#lt

    •E)emp(o com Perman:ncia e Retração

    G85 Z 6 $ J D

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    38/45

     

    G85 Z 6 $ J D

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    39/45

     

    • GZ4. A

    • G85 Z48. 614. $. J100 D1. A

    • X50. Y14. A• Y50. A

    • G80A

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    40/45

     

    • @6@B2 J6X2 DE $2:@%$ #8;

    •  % f#nção #8; po&&ibilita a exe(#ção de # ro&(aento

    e # f#ro (o a #tiliHação de a(ho para ro&(ar 

    • 2 (i(lo fixo G83 !ira o eixo r'ore no inQ(io do (i(loo'e&e e rpido ao plano$ e e 'elo(idade dea'anço at) a prof#ndidade e&pe(ifi(ada.

    • "#ando a prof#ndidade final ) atin!ida, a rotação doeixo r'ore ) re'ertida +&entido antihorrio-a#toati(aente. Jinalente a ferraenta retorna e'elo(idade de a'anço a po&ição e&pe(ifi(ada

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    41/45

     

    G83 Z $ J

    NOTA:

    $?M 518?a&&o 1,4 J 518x 1.4377

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    42/45

     

    • NOTA:• $?M 518•

    ?a&&o 1,4 • J 518x 1.4377

    • G83 Z14. $4. J377A• X4. Y0. A

    • X30.Y50. A• G80A

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    43/45

     

    • CICLO !I7O 1E MAN1RILAMENTO - #85

    •2 (i(lo fixo G84 po&&ibilita a exe(#ção daoperação de andrilaento.

    • Mo'e&e e rpido at) o plano$,

    •  %!e e 'elo(idade de a'anço at) aprof#ndidade e&pe(ifi(ada,

    • at#a #a peranFn(ia op(ional e então

    • retorna ao plano$ o# ao RZR ini(ial e'elo(idade de a'anço o# e a'anço de retração

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    44/45

     

    G84 $. Z0. J30 S142 D1

  • 8/18/2019 Aula sobre CNC com função de circulo em máquina ROMI

    45/45

    • GZ4. A

    • G84$.Z0.J30 S142D1.A

    • X50.Y30. A• Y0. A

    • G80A